Hivelist is one of the communities I discovered that has a great potential in the mid-July. I decided to add the LIST token to my curation portfolio not necessarily for curation, but for a discounted cost of securing a Hivelist website. It was motivating to see that a Hivecommerce website could be created with $100 and with just a $15 monthly maintenance fee. So far, a few other cryptos are accepted as payment options.

Your store will have other options that will be available as well such as Paypal or Stripe for fiat, and Coinbase Commerce plugin if you want to accept BTC, ETH, BCH, LTC, USDC, and DAI as well. For this, you will need a Coinbase Commerce account which you can set up here. You can choose to set up those accounts at a later time. The only payment plugin that will be turned on by default will the the Hive payments plugin. - source

However, holding stakes of LIST token gives a user discounts on the monthly website maintenance fee.
